Rodmarton Manor garden


Rodmarton Manor gardens are divided into different areas by bold hedges of various species. Retaining virtually all of its original features; the holly hedges, the limes by the circle, the beech hedges, the yew hedges. Today it is gardened with great energy, showing off the topiary terrace, white garden, rockery, wild garden and hornbeam-avenue. The magnificent herbaceous borders are full of interest from May to September with peak flowering in late June but with many later flowering plants for the end of the summer. There is a large kitchen garden with a variety of plants both culinary and ornamental, including a new collection of old and scented roses.
